#059 305 58cc L30 Vortec heads on a stock 75 400sbc?
Hello sofa, fast355, Orr, et al
Can #059 L30 305 Vortec 58cc heads with steam holes drilled be used on a stock 76 #509 400 sbc short block with 93 pump gas for street use?
Stock cam, adequate radiator, outside air intake, #1014 gaskets, & adjusted timing would be addressed. Initial look tentatively has the pistons .025 in the hole.
The stock pistons have a circular dish with slight valve reliefs.
I have found that the piston dishes could be 18 cc 22 cc in volume.
Also, instead of the usual VIN stamping deck boss below the front of the passenger cylinder head, theres a very short square blank block devoid of any numbers.
it does not appear to be decked at all.
Maybe because its a dedicated RV 400 small block.
Would this head/block combination detonate itself to death or have a chance of living on the street with occasional spirited driving?
Thanks
